I would suggest looking at whats available already in SACDs, to see if its worth it to you to have the format.
I bought an SACD player primarily for all the new jazz stuff (Analogue Productions) slated to be released, and now have a whopping 8 discs (well, that and a few misc. others like Mofi Pixies).
Other than jazz or classical there doesn't seem to be much action for SACDs. I'm quite pleased with the SONY ES player though, and it does a fantastic job w/ Redbook too.
Its definitely the best source I've heard under $1500, possibly the best I've heard period.
